Migraine is a complex neurological disorder that manifests with recurrent headache, nausea, vomiting, photophobia or phonophobia. Theprevalence of migraine is 15% to 20% in women and 4% to 7% in men. In children the prevalence may be as high as 17% and isequal in boys and girls. The highest prevalence occur between the ages of 25yrs and 55 yrs. Based on sign and symptoms of Ardhavabhedaka. It can be compared with migraine. Objective of this study is to compare theefficacy of Gandharyadi ghrita nasya and Go ghrita nasya along with internalmedication as Narikela khanda in the management of Ardhavabhedaka. Study will conduct in AIIA hospital with taken 15patients in each groups by block randomization. Diagnosis of patient will bedone according Intrernational headache society for migraine. Primary assessmentparameter will pain and secondary will quality of life. Total duration of thisstudy will be 53days.

入选标准
- •Patients having symptoms of Ardhavabhedaka , 1) Ardha parshwa Shirashoola– unilateral headache 2) Bheda , Toda, Shoola- pulsating , throbbing type of pain 3) Pakshat, Dashahat ,Akasmat- paroxysmal episodes.
- •Prakasha Asahishnata- photophobia, Nausea (Hrillas), vomiting (Chardi).
- •phonophobia.
排除标准
- •Known cases of Secondary headache caused by sinusitis , meningitis , brain tumour, increased intra ocular pressure , malignant HTN.
